Cable Network definition

Cable Network means a hybrid fibre-coax Electronic Communications Network that uses a combination of optical fibres and coaxial cable;

More Definitions of Cable Network

Cable Network means a television network making programming available for viewing by any technology other than over-the- air broadcast (whether or not retransmitted via cable), including, without limitation, cable television, MMDS, SMATV, DBS, TVRO and so-called "superstations".

Cable Network means a network where cable broadcasts and IPTV broadcast services are transmitted to subscribers through any kind of cable infrastructure;
Cable Network means any essentially wireline terrestrial network serving principally to transmit or retransmit public television or radio services, including master antenna and cable television systems and other telecommunications networks covered by this definition. The term "cable network" also covers all other terrestrial, including virtual, wired and Hertzian networks, except those using Luxembourgish broadcasting frequencies that transmit or retransmit television or radio services selected by the operator;
